The Fairy Stream (Suoi Tien)

Your first stop around 1:15 PM is the Fairy Stream, a natural marvel with crystalline, ankle-deep water flowing through colorful sandbanks. We loved how this spot combines nature’s artwork with a peaceful walk—wear shoes you don’t mind getting wet. Several travelers, like Frances, mention how this stop is both photogenic and relaxing, with the added bonus of options like ostrich riding (extra charge).

Fishing Village

Next, around 2:45 PM, you visit a local fishing village, where you can observe the daily routines of Vietnamese fishermen and get a glimpse of authentic coastal life. It’s an unpretentious, genuine look at the local economy and tradition, far removed from touristy spots.

White Sand Dunes & ATV Fun

By 3:45 PM, you arrive at the White Sand Dunes. Here, the sand is so white and fine that it looks almost surreal. You have the chance to rent quad bikes (additional cost) or try sand sliding—a favorite among travelers like Vincent, who called the ATV ride “thrilling.” The slopes are steep enough for excitement but manageable, and the experience offers a great way to see the dunes from a different perspective.

Red Sand Dunes and Sunset

Around 5:00 PM, your journey continues to the Red Sand Dunes. The slopes are less steep, making it perfect for family-friendly photos and relaxing walks. As the sun begins to dip, you’ll witness a spectacular sunset that turns the crimson sands into a fiery masterpiece, a highlight that many reviews, including those from Kalifa, describe as “incredible.”

Transportation and Logistics

From Ho Chi Minh To Mui Ne Best Day Trip | Sunset Tour - Transportation and Logistics

One of the tour’s big selling points is the round-trip luxury sleeper bus. It ensures you start and end your day comfortably, especially after a full day of sightseeing. The journey might be longer than some expect, but travelers report the bus is air-conditioned and clean, making the long hours more bearable. The pickup is straightforward—229 Pham Ngu Lao Street—and the guides are responsive, providing confirmation via WhatsApp or email.

The itinerary is tightly scheduled but flexible enough to accommodate extra activities like ATV riding, which costs around 15 USD per person. Keep in mind, the sand sliding board costs about 2 USD, offering a quick thrill. Surcharges during holidays (like Lunar New Year) are about 460,000 VND (roughly 20 USD), payable directly to the driver.

What’s Included and What’s Extra

For the price, you get transportation, an English-speaking guide, a local dinner, water, juices, and free photo editing from the tour team. It’s a good deal considering the number of stops and activities. Extra expenses include ATV rides and sand sliding, and tips are appreciated but not obligatory.

FAQs

From Ho Chi Minh To Mui Ne Best Day Trip | Sunset Tour - FAQs

Is this tour suitable for all ages?
Most travelers up to their mid-90s find it manageable. The tour is wheelchair accessible, but the longer travel and activities like ATV riding might be challenging for some.

What should I bring?
Comfortable shoes, a hat, sandals, a camera, biodegradable sunscreen, light clothes, cash, and a charged smartphone are recommended. A small towel is useful for wading in the Fairy Stream.

Are meals included?
Yes, the tour provides a local dinner, but the options may be basic. Many travelers recommend bringing extra snacks or fruit for variety.

How long is the bus ride?
About 2 hours and 45 minutes each way on a comfortable sleeper bus with air conditioning. The journey is long but generally well-regarded for comfort.

Can I rent an ATV?
Yes, ATV rides are available at an additional cost, around 15 USD for 20 minutes, or 35 USD if renting for 20 minutes for two people plus a driver.

What makes sunset at the red dunes special?
Many reviews describe the sunset as “incredible,” with hues that turn the dunes a fiery red, perfect for photography.

Is there free time during the day?
The schedule is packed, but you’ll have about an hour at the Fairy Stream and some time in the fishing village. Most activities are organized with little free time for wandering.

Are tips expected?
Tipping is appreciated but not compulsory. It’s up to your discretion based on service.

What if I need to cancel?
You can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, making it flexible if your plans change.
